cPGuard is a security suite that contains anti-virus/anti-malware scanner, file injection cleanup option, WAF, distributed firewall, server reputation check, rootkit scanner, etc . Using this complete security package, the server administration time reduces a lot due to web attacks and hacks.

  • Antivirus
    If you really need another antivirus alternative for whatever reason the only recommendation is ClamWin which is based on ClamAV which is basically the only open source antivirus option available, but it don't real-time scanner.ClamWin which is based on ClamAV which is basically the only open source antivirus option available, but it don't have real-time scanner so you need to scan the files manually.
